Financials | |||||
General | Simplified Data Model in SAP S/4HANA Financials | With SAP S/4HANA, on-premise edition identically-named DDL SQL views (compatibility views) replace totals and application index tables in Finance. These views are generated from DDL sources. The replacement takes place during the conversion using SUM. Related data is saved to backup tables. The compatibility views ensure that database SELECTs still work. However, write access (INSERT, UPDATE, DELETE, MODIFY) was removed from SAP standard, or has to be removed from custom code. For more information, see SAP Note 1976487 |

MM-IM Inventory Management | Simplified inventory management data model |
Significant changes of the data model. The new de-normalized table MATDOC has been introduced which contains the former header and item data of a material document as well as a range of other attributes. Material document data is stored in MATDOC only. Actual stock quantity data will be calculated on-the-fly from the new material document table MATDOC for which some of those additional special fields are used. Adoption effort on DDIC level for customer appends and coding adjustments for performance critical parts may be required Restrictions : Printing & Archiving of Material Documents is not possible. It is planned to be realized for the next Service Pack. (snote# 2237351) 2206980 – Material Inventory Managment: change of data model in S/4HANA 2259038 – S/4HANA: Partitioning of table MATDOC 2236753 – S/4HANA MM-IM migration: error, post-processing and info messages |

MM-IM Inventory Management | Material Valuation |
Material Ledger Obligatory for Material Valuation. Even though Material Ledger is become obligatorily active, Actual Costing is not. Activation of Actual Costing is still optional. If customers are not using the material ledger already it will be activated during the conversion process. In MM02 and MR21 material prices can now be maintained in multiple currencies. In Financials the inventory account balances are calculated separately for each currency and result therefore in a cleaner and more consistent valuation in other currencies than the local currency Conversion Pre-Checks SAP Note: 2194618 SAP Note: 2129306 Custom Code related information SAP Notes: 1804812 ————– Before S/4HANA, the inventory valuation tables xBEW(H) – tables: EBEW, EBEWH, MBEW, MBEWH, OBEW, OBEWH, QBEW, QBEWH – contain transactional as well as master data attributes. With S/4HANA, the inventory valuation tables do still exist as DDIC definition as well as database object. However, they will only be used to store material master data attributes. The transactional fields LBKUM, SALK3 and SALKV will be retrieved from the Material Ledger. (From S/4HANA 1610 these transactional fields will be retrieved from the Universal Journal Entry Line Items table ACDOCA and the Material Ledger table. For more detailed information please see SAP Note: 2337383). |
You need to migrate the Material Ledger even if you are already using SAP Simple Finance (that is, you are migrating from SAP Simple Finance to SAP S/4 HANA Inventory Management).
In addition, you need to migrate the Material Ledger even if you are already using the Material Ledger in your source system.
If you performing an upgrade from S/4HANA 1511 to S/4HANA 1610, no manual IMG Material Ledger data migration is necessary. |

PLM – Product Lifecycle Management | BOM, Routing, and Production Version | Only BOMs with valid production version are considered during BOM explosion. Therefore, it is mandatory for manufacturing BOMs to maintain the product version for correct BOM explosion. For all BOMs in the system, we recommend to maintain product versions using the report Product Version Migration for BOM (Report : CS_BOM_PRODVER_MIGRATION). | |||

PP | MRP-LIVE |
The HANA-Optimized MRP —————————- SAP S/4HANA features MRP Live –> an MRP run optimized for SAP HANA. * MRP Live reads material receipts and requirements, calculates shortages, and creates planned orders and purchase requisitions all in one database procedure – Optimizes Performance * The definition of the planning scope is more flexible. MRP Live allows you to plan a set of materials with all components, materials for which a certain production planner is responsible, or one material across all plants. * MRP Live determines the sequence in which materials have to be planned across several plants. —————————————– Classic MRP is still available as an interim solution, which at the moment has to be used in the following cases: (1) Capacity requirements shall be created by MRP (2) For creating MRP lists. ———————————————– MRP live differs from classic MRP in the following aspects: * MRP live does not write MRP lists. * Multi-level, make-to-order planning (transaction MD50) is not optimized for HANA. * Individual project planning (transaction MD51) is not optimized for HANA. * The creation indicator for purchase requisitions is not available in MRP Live. MRP Live always creates purchase requisitions if the material is procured externally. * The creation indicator for delivery schedule lines is not available in MRP Live. MRP Live always creates delivery schedule lines if a valid delivery schedule exists. MRP-Live Limitations ** The actual benefit of MRP-LIVE will depend on the following: MRP features used, Number of materials planned using MRP-LIVE, Number of materials planned using Classic MRP, Number of low-level codes. In MRP Live, following functions are not supported: *BAdIs no Longer Supported * MRP Live does not support net change planning in the planning horizon. The planning horizon is ignored. * Multi-level, make-to-order planning (transaction MD50) is not optimized for MRP Live. * Individual project planning (transaction MD51) is not optimized for MRP Live. * The new MRP Live is designed to be faster but will not support all these existing business processes right away. Custom-Code check – LONG LIST of checks…..….. MRP Live is implemented in SQLScript running on the database server as opposed to classic ABAP code, which is performed on the application server. Any enhancement or BAdI implementation of the classic MRP run does not work with MRP Live. A new set of AMDP BADIs will be available for MRP Live from SAP S/4HANA on-premise edition 1603. BAdI implementations of the classic MRP have to be translated into AMDP BAdI implementations if still required. list of BADIs |

PP | Simplified Sourcing |
MAJOR Logic change & Simplification makes ERP sourcing and PP/DS sourcing become more similar. The different sources of supply are pretty symmetrical. Sources of supply have a temporal validity, a quantitative validity, a deletion indicator, and a “relevant for automatic sourcing” indicator. The sourcing logic can treat the different sources of supply in a uniform way Quota arrangements can be used to prioritize any of the possible sources of supply Purchasing info records are proper sources of supply. The SAP S/4HANA MRP can select purchasing info records without source list entries. It is sufficient to define the supplier information of a material in the purchasing info record. Production versions make sure BOM and routing fit together Production versions have always been the only in-house production source of supply integrated with APO PP/DS. With production versions as the only in-house production source of supply, ERP sourcing and PP/DS sourcing become more similar. Purchasing info records, contracts, and delivery schedules have always been the external procurement sources of supply integrated with APO. With purchasing info records being proper sources of supply, ERP sourcing and PP/DS sourcing become more similar A unified source of supply model is the basis for future innovations in sourcing Impact on Customer Coding If you implemented BADI MD_MODIFY_SOURCE in SAP ERP, then one should check if the intended functionality still works. Also check changes in alignment with “MRP-LIVE” – Optimized MRP processing. |

SCM-CIF | Interfacing with CIF |
CIF does not work with LONG Material Number “The Core Interface which is used to transfer master data from S4HANA to another application like SAP EWM, SAP TM or SAP SCM does not support the new long material numbers. In case the automated exchange of master data using CIF is required the material number field length extension has to be deactivated in the following IMG-activity: In Customizing for S4HANA, choose -> Cross-Application Components -> General Application Functions -> Field Length Extension -> uncheck: Extended Material Number” |

General | Co-Deployment with SAP Supplier Relationship Management (SAP SRM) |
If you run SAP SRM and SAP Business Suite on one server, you cannot convert your system to SAP S/4HANA. It is not possible to install the SAP SRM software components within the SAP S/4HANA stack. Accordingly, the related conversion pre-check prevents such systems from being converted. If you run SAP SRM and Business Suite on separate servers, you can continue to integrate SAP SRM with the converted SAP S/4HANA system |

Billing | Output Management Simplified output management in SD Billing |
With SAP S/4HANA a new output management approach is in place. The target architecture is based on Adobe Document Server and Adobe Forms only. Billing documents that are migrated from legacy systems and for which NAST based output have been determined, can be processed with this technology. For all new billing documents the new output management is used. Therefore, in the area billing / customer invoice you need to adapt the configuration settings related to output management. |

SD-Pricing | Data Model Changes in Pricing |
• Introduction of PRCD_ELEMENTS & PRCD_ELEM_DRAFT • Data Elements Changed • Length of several data elements changed • “Obsolete Fields” not available in PRCD_ELEMENTS ** Cookbooks provided by SAP, however code-adaption Custom-CODE will require definitive efforts. Post-processing report PRC_MIG_POST_PROCESSING ASAP Impact on Customer DDIC enhancements append structure to PRCD_ELEMENTS & PRCD_ELEM_DRAFT Append PRCD_Elements in conversion phase SPDD enhance CDS view V_KONV & V_KONV_DRAFT Impact on Customer Coding It is strictly forbidden to insert, update, or delete any entries in database table KONV directly. Mandatory to use the new pricing result API to access the database layer (new pricing result API is part of package VF_PRC_DB) |

"Additional currency feature" in Material Ledger :
Latest trends in material management aim for improved and more flexible valuation methods in multiple currencies and parallel accounting standards while simultaneously reducing required system resources and improving scalability of the business processes. Since the data model of the Material Ledger module supports these business requirements, it was chosen as the basis for material inventory valuation in the new solution SAP S/4HANA.
You need to migrate the Material Ledger even if you are already using SAP Simple Finance (that is, you are migrating from SAP Simple Finance to SAP S/4 HANA Inventory Management).
In addition, you need to migrate the Material Ledger even if you are already using the Material Ledger in your source system.
If you performing
an upgrade from S/4HANA 1511 to S/4HANA 1610, no manual IMG Material Ledger data migration is necessary.
It is very important to distinguish between Material Ledger, in its role as an inventory subledger in Accounting,
and business feature Actual Costing. Material Ledger, as the inventory subledger, valuates material inventories
in multiple currencies and GAAPs in parallel. In addition Material Ledger is a base prerequisite for the use of
Actual Costing. With Actual Costing you can evaluate your material inventories, work in process and cost of
goods sold with weighted average unit costs that are being calculated after the fact by evaluating business
transactions of one or several posting periods. Also other features, e.g. actual cost component split, are
provided by Actual Costing.
Even though Material Ledger is become obligatorily active, Actual Costing is not. Activation of Actual Costing is still optional.
